Molaison, Jr. WRIT GRANTED FOR LIMITED PURPOSES Relator, Irvin Harris, was convicted in Jefferson Parish for two counts of second degree murder, in violation of La. R.S. 14:30.1 (counts one and two); one count of illegal possession of a stolen firearm, in violation of La. R.S. 14:69.1 (count three); and one count of conspiracy to commit obstruction of justice, in violation of La. R.S. 14:26 and 14:130.1 (count five). On January 16, 2015, the trial court sentenced defendant to the following: life imprisonment without benefit of probation, parole, or suspension of sentence on counts one and two; five years at hard labor on count three; and twenty years at hard labor on count five, to be served concurrently. On appeal, this court affirmed relator’s convictions and sentences for second degree murder and illegal possession of a stolen firearm; however, upon finding that the State failed to produce sufficient evidence at trial to sustain relator’s conviction for conspiracy to commit obstruction of justice, we reversed his conviction and vacated his sentence on that count. State v. Harris, 15485 (La. App. 5 Cir. 4/13/16), 190 So.3d 466, 469, writ denied, 16-0902 (La. 5/12/17), 220 So.3d 746 According to the official record in this matter, relator made several filings on June 20, 2019, captioned as “Appendix Of Exhibits Attached In Support Application For Post Conviction Relief With Attached Memorandum,” which consisted of exhibits “A” through “I”. On June 26, 2019, the trial court issued an Order that acknowledged the filing of relator’s exhibits, but denied relief on the basis that relator did not include an application for post-conviction relief (“APCR”) or memorandum in support for the court’s review. In the instant application, relator contends that the Clerk of Court misplaced his APCR. Relator also includes 19-KH-358 what appears to be a copy of the memorandum in support of the APCR filed in the district court in which he asserts his claims. Based upon our review of the application and information provided by relator, we find relator has demonstrated that he initially gave his APCR to be mailed by authorities at Angola on May 10, 2019, and that it was delivered to Gretna on May 13, 2019.1 At that time, relator’s APCR would have been timely. However, for reasons unknown, relator’s filing was not made an official part of the record by the Jefferson Parish Clerk of Court. Accordingly, in the interest of justice, we grant relator’s instant application for the limited purpose of transferring the ACPR contained therein to the district court for consideration along with the exhibits previously filed and acknowledged by the district court.
